Terminate the process by clicking on the “X,” and it will restart automatically. Restart your sound controller by opening the “Activity Monitor” and locating “coreaudiod” in the process list.If you want the sound to play through your headphones or speakers while your TV is on, you need to switch to your speakers by clicking on the audio icon found in the Mac menu bar.If your TV is connected via HDMI, for example, your sound is probably being redirected to the TV instead of the headphones or speakers.
